Finding 'The Truth' books in paperback or ebook depends on what you prioritize—convenience, price, or supporting indie sellers. For paperbacks, Amazon is the most reliable, but I also scour Barnes & Noble’s website for exclusive editions. ThriftBooks is fantastic for budget-friendly used copies, and their condition is usually solid. If you’re into ebooks, Kindle Unlimited might have them if they’re part of a series, but I’d also check Scribd for subscription-based access.

For a more ethical approach, Bookshop.org supports local bookstores and often has competitive pricing. Libro.fm is another alternative for audiobook lovers who want DRM-free files. Don’t forget library apps like Hoopla or OverDrive—you can borrow ebooks for free if your library subscribes. I’ve discovered some niche retailers like Powell’s Books for rare paperback prints, so it’s worth digging deeper if you’re a collector.

Where can I buy the idiot book in paperback or ebook?

1 Answers2025-08-11 19:41:12
I can totally relate to the struggle of tracking down a specific title like 'The Idiot.' For paperback copies, I’ve had great luck with online retailers like Amazon, Barnes & Noble, and Book Depository. Amazon usually has both new and used options, and if you’re okay with pre-loved books, you can often snag a copy for a fraction of the price. Book Depository is fantastic if you’re outside the US since they offer free worldwide shipping, which is a huge plus. For ebook versions, platforms like Kindle, Google Play Books, and Kobo are my go-to spots. They often have sales, so it’s worth checking regularly if you’re not in a rush. If you prefer supporting smaller businesses, indie bookstores often carry classics like 'The Idiot,' especially if it’s part of a required reading list or a popular edition. Websites like AbeBooks or ThriftBooks specialize in secondhand books and can be treasure troves for hard-to-find editions. Libraries are another underrated resource—many offer ebook lending through apps like Libby or OverDrive, so you can borrow 'The Idiot' for free if you’re okay with a temporary copy. Audiobook versions are also available on Audible or Scribd if you’re into that format. The key is to compare prices and shipping times, especially if you’re hunting for a specific translation or edition.
